Plan on letting a qualified machinist tell you what it needs. Don’t plan on a .030 overbore today.
 
Plan on letting a qualified machinist tell you what it needs. Don’t plan on a .030 overbore today.
The last engine I had rebuilt was a 1976 "400" . It had a seized piston from moisture and the cylinders cleaned up with only a .020 overbore.
 
I went through the “overbore” discussion many times. I thought it really needed only a .010 over cleanup. In the end it all had to do with I cost. There are “standard” .030 over pistons and rings that are readily available and inexpensive. Any variation to the size and you’d better have deep pockets. Find a decent machinist and then carefully consider their advise.
 
As Chrysler B/RB engines oil the hydraulic lifters first, then the crank, the crank bearing wear can be the "dam" that's worn, so to speak. By comparison, the small block Chevy oils the mains, then the lifters. Reason? A typical Chrysler customer would hear the lifters ticking first, rather than a main bearing THUMP. In a time when the engine's oil got checked at alomst every fuel stop by a kind service station attendant. FWIW

But to do the main/rod bearings, the best way is to remove the engine from the car. Put it on an engine stand and flip it over to do "a crank kit" (turned crank with matching bearings, usually .010"/.010" undersize, which is usually what it would take to clean things up nicely.

IF there's "oil consumption", a logical place is the valve stem seals. Which have probably deteriorated due to heat and age. You can do those without removing the valves, but if you find valve stem/guide wear, a new seal will not last as long as it should, due to valve wobble and such. So that would normally mean disassembling the head to refresh the guides with bronze helicoil guide inserts being installed (rather than the time-honored knurling lof prior times, which also makes the bronze the wear-interface that can be redone later, when needed. Which will also allow for a re-touching of the valve seats/valve replacements as needed.

Which means that when the heads are off, you can look for "clean areas" near the outer edges of the pistons. Where oil coming up front the bottom will wash away any accumulated carbon build-up due to oil ring wear. Which then can get into the whole "piston/ring" deal. Some used to call an "overhaul" a "ring and bearing" operation. If there were no piston knocks upon cold start-up, then just new rings and touching the cylinder walls with a hone for good measure, lightly, if at all.

Just curious, have you tried running any internal engine cleaner additives in the oil lately? To see if they might help? It's possible, too, that those "ticks" are really in the upper valve train rather than in the lifters specifically. How much oil consumption is there?

I know that it can be harder to get to the spark plugs on a Fuselage car than a "slab", but you can also do a borescope inspection of the individual cylinders. One of those "critter cams" can be purchased pretty inexpensively. Or a borescope cable (and program) for your laptop or cell phone, too. Which could give you an idea of the piston tops and such.

There was a thread in hear a year or so ago on how to address some engine-related things. What could start out as "simple things first" could easily escalate into a full-blown engine rebuild to fix a small issue. One thing leads to another! Many $$$$ later to "do it right".

Also need to resist the desire to "make it better than stock", which leads to even more $$$, usually. A few things like full-groove main bearings might be good to do, when necessary, but otherwise, "stock" is plenty good with OEM-spec replacement parts, by observation. Used to be "good" for 80K+ miles, with the oils we had back then, so they should be good for much longer with todays better motor oils (with sufficient zddp content).
